Summary:
"Ivy, Dulcie, Barbara, Ann, Dorothy and Jean all had different reasons for applying to work at Carr's biscuits, but once they had put on their overalls and walked through the factory gates they discovered a community full of life, laughter and friendship. Beginning in the 1940s, these heartwarming and vividly-remembered stories were collected by the author. In 1831 John Dodgson Carr, son of a Quaker grocer, was determined to launch a great enterprise. Within 15 years, Carr's of
Carlisle
had become one of the largest baking businesses in the world, and is a by-word for biscuits to this day.
Carlisle
is in Cumbria and is the second most northerly city in
England
. Hunter Davies is the author of over forty books, including the only official biography of the Beatles"--Provided by publisher.
